Founded by Park Byoung Uk, Nine Dragon Heads is an international art collective that focuses on the relationship between mankind and nature. This publication contains the complete collection and results of projects undertaken by Nine Dragon Heads from 2007 to 2010, including exhibitions, performances, conferences and workshops. Among the projects featured is 'Nomadic Party' from August to September 2010, which combines an exhibition at Arko Art Center, Seoul and a joint journey by a group of international artists along the Silk Road in Northwest China. They travel through the Gobi, Taklamakan Deserts and the Tian Shan Mountains, creating works such as installations and multidisciplinary performances en route that place emphasis on cultural exchange and interaction with the environment.

With project summaries, timelines, images of artworks, essays, and reviews.
